numam-dpdk/drivers/net/mvneta
Thomas Monjalon 3041049375 drivers/net: check process type in close operation
The secondary processes are not allowed to release shared resources.
Only process-private resources should be freed in a secondary process.
Most of the time, there is no process-private resource,
so the close operation is just forbidden in a secondary process.

After adding proper check in the port close functions,
some redundant checks in the device remove functions are dropped.

Signed-off-by: Thomas Monjalon <thomas@monjalon.net>
Reviewed-by: Rosen Xu <rosen.xu@intel.com>
Reviewed-by: Sachin Saxena <sachin.saxena@oss.nxp.com>
Reviewed-by: Ajit Khaparde <ajit.khaparde@broadcom.com>
Reviewed-by: Liron Himi <lironh@marvell.com>
Reviewed-by: Haiyue Wang <haiyue.wang@intel.com>
Acked-by: Jeff Guo <jia.guo@intel.com>
Reviewed-by: Andrew Rybchenko <arybchenko@solarflare.com>
Acked-by: Stephen Hemminger <stephen@networkplumber.org>
2020-09-30 19:19:14 +02:00
..
meson.build drivers: add reasons for components being disabled 2019-07-02 23:21:11 +02:00
mvneta_ethdev.c drivers/net: check process type in close operation 2020-09-30 19:19:14 +02:00
mvneta_ethdev.h net/mvneta: optimize checksum generation offload 2019-07-03 12:57:30 +02:00
mvneta_rxtx.c net/mvneta: optimize checksum generation offload 2019-07-03 12:57:30 +02:00
mvneta_rxtx.h net/mvneta: support Rx/Tx 2018-10-11 18:53:48 +02:00
rte_pmd_mvneta_version.map version: 20.11-rc0 2020-08-12 11:32:16 +02:00